Precisamos conversar sobre o PhotoGIMP AppImage

Avisos:

  • Pra quem não conhece, clique aqui pra conhecer o projeto
  • Esse texto cobre apenas a versão AppImage da qual eu sou o mantenedor
Caso queira apenas as conclusões sem saber as justificativas, clique nessa linha
  • O projeto não será cancelado
  • O projeto mudará de nome
  • O projeto será completamente desligado do PhotoGIMP do Diolinux
  • O projeto deixará de ser apenas uma imitação do layout do Photoshop e passará a implementar ativamente funções que estão ou não disponíveis no software da Adobe
  • Ainda não existe uma release, assim que tiver uma release eu faço um post de lançamento, como ocorreu antes

Motivação desse post

O PhotoGIMP AppImage se tornou um projeto muito mais popular que eu pensei que chegaria, foram mais de 3000 Downloads, sendo que 500 vieram de um post que eu fiz aqui no fórum a 1 ano e 2 meses, então acho que seria justo comunicar aqui no fórum uma mudança tão significativa nos rumos do projeto.

Mas afinal o que muda?

As principais mudanças visuais estão mostradas no print abaixo:

  • O Wilber não está presente mais, apesar de eu gostar muito do Wilber, um visual mais clean me parece mais produtivo

  • Os icones são maiores, conforme alguns usuários pediram, os ícones da caixa de ferramentas está maior

  • Adicionada as abas, isso foi outro pedido de usuários, agora as abas Histórico de desfazer, Cores, Paletas e Pintura Simétrica estão ativas, na parte inferior foi adicionada a camada de vetores

  • Novo menu “Desenho” esse menu vai permitir um suporte primitivo a shapes usando vetores

Mas porque mudar?

Primeiro e mais óbvio, essas mudanças foram sugeridas pelos próprios usuários do então PhotoGIMP AppImage e outras de insights que eu tive, uma das mais recentes foi o “Ajustes rápidos” de camadas:

screen01

Eu não gostava da ideia de me limitar a imitar o layout do Photoshop, eu queria poder implementar funções “faltantes” no GIMP, e aqui entra o primeiro motivo de desvencilhar do PhotoGIMP do @Diolinux, ao usar o nome do PhotoGIMP eu não poderia simplesmente lançar uma nova função, porque isso causaria dissonâncias com o projeto original, eu teria que por exemplo esperar o Diolinux lançar (se ele quisesse lançar) a feature para só então eu poder lançar a AppImage, até porque de caso contrário no mínimo eu estaria fazendo os usuários de beta tester e isso de longe seria algo bom a se fazer

Mas porque se desvencilhar?

Pra começar o motivo citado anteriormente já seria suficiente, mas tenho vários outros, como por exemplo os scripts geradores a partir de arquivos SVG como o “Sunburst” (Arquivo->Criar->Sunburst):
screen02
Para garantir que o feito funcione em computadores mais fracos mesmo em imagens de alta resolução, a saída encontrada foi usar arquivos SVG para serem usados como máscaras o problema é que isso requer que os arquivos SVG estejam na pasta “data” do gimp para que o arquivo se torne portável, ou seja eu teria que acessar a pasta “usr/share/gimp/” o que nas versões não AppImage iriam requerer mexer com pastas do sistema o que seria ruim, ou no caso de snaps impossível… isso me deixou com a escolha entre desistir desses recursos ou me desligar do PhotoGIMP, porém o que me deu o sinal que esse era o certo a se fazer foi o lançamento do PhotoGIMP 2020 onde não existe até o presente momento qualquer menção a versão AppImage do PhotoGIMP nem do GIMP em si nesse formato (o que é de livre escolha do @Dio e eu não tenho absolutamente nada contra isso, o projeto é dele e ele o toca da forma que achar melhor), porém se passaram mais de 1 anos desde o anuncio da versão em AppImage e em nenhum momento foi feito ao menos um post nos canais oficiais o que sinaliza que mesmo tendo conhecimento sobre o projeto, eles optaram por não associar o PhotoGIMP by @Diolinux com o PhotoGIMP as AppImage, além do mais essa versão é focada em Flatpaks (o que novamente eu não tenho absolutamente nada contra isso, o projeto é dele e ele o toca da forma que achar melhor) o que provavelmente é a forma como ele gostaria de que o projeto fosse distribuído. Esses foram o conjunto de motivos que me levaram a desvencilhar do PhotoGIMP

A nova branding

Devido a separação do PhotoGIMP o meu projeto mudará de nome e terá um novo ícone e splashscreen diferentes com o objetivo de eliminar quaisquer referência ao projeto do @Diolinux

Onde baixar a nova versão?

Ainda não tenho nenhuma release, porém assim que tiver eu faço um post de lançamento como foi da outra vez


Se você chegou até aqui, obrigado e até breve :grinning:

12 curtidas

Boa sorte e esperemos o que vai brotar daí!

6 curtidas

Acho muito legal que o meu projetinho tenha gerado algo maior assim, eu vou ficar de olho na ideia toda e se puder ajudar de alguma forma, conte comigo :slight_smile:

7 curtidas

Olá Dio, boa tarde, desculpe a demora em responder, uma coisa que ajudaria muito no projeto seria uma review em vídeo quanto sair a release pública, pode não parecer mas tem muita coisa nova e diferente nele

1 curtida

Tem alguma previsão para a release ou vai ser lançado baseado no “quando estiver tudo pronto”?

1 curtida

Tenho sim, o lançamento está planejado para 20/08/2020, a partir de quarta feira (12/08/2020) eu vou começar a liberar drops em forma de vídeo mostrando o que já está pronto

2 curtidas

Ficarei no aguardo :wink: